GMC Canyon Core Specifications

FeatureSpecification
Engine2.7L Turbocharged High-Output I4
Horsepower310 hp
Torque430 lb-ft
Max Towing CapacityUp to 7,700 lbs
Transmission8-Speed Automatic
Drivetrain2WD or 4WD (Trim dependent)
Ground Clearance9.6 to 10.7 inches (AT4X)

Turbocharged Performance – Class-Leading Torque and Towing

The high-output 2.7L engine delivers a best-in-class 430 lb-ft of torque, ensuring immediate throttle response under heavy loads. This powertrain allows for a maximum towing capacity of 7,700 lbs, outperforming most competitors in the mid-size category. Whether climbing steep grades or overtaking on the highway, the engine maintains peak efficiency without sacrificing raw strength.

Off-Road Design – Rugged Aesthetics for Extreme Terrains

A factory-installed lift comes standard across the lineup, providing an aggressive stance and superior approach angles for technical trails. The exterior features ultra-wide tracks and high-clearance bumpers to minimize obstacles during rock crawling. Durable skid plates and recovery hooks are integrated into the chassis to protect vital components during intense off-road excursions.

Premium Interior Design – Luxury Meets Utility

The driver-centric cockpit utilizes high-quality materials like perforated leather and authentic wood trim in higher grades like the Denali. Ergonomic seating ensures long-distance comfort, while the noise-canceling cabin architecture minimizes road and engine drone. Large physical knobs for climate and audio provide tactile control, even when wearing work gloves.

Advanced Safety Systems – Comprehensive Driver Protection

GMC Pro Safety comes standard, featuring automated emergency braking and lane-keep assist to prevent collisions before they occur. The truck utilizes a suite of high-resolution cameras, including segment-first underbody views, to help navigate tight trails or hitch trailers with precision. Blind-zone steering assist provides an extra layer of security when navigating dense highway traffic.

Next-Gen Technology – Seamless Connectivity and Monitoring

The 11.3-inch diagonal touchscreen serves as the central hub, featuring Google Built-in for real-time navigation and voice commands. An available 11-inch fully digital driver information center allows for customizable displays of mechanical vitals and off-road telemetry. Wireless Apple CarPlay and Android Auto integration ensure the driver stays connected without the clutter of physical cables.

Unmatched Versatility – Optimized Cargo and Storage

The MultiStow Tailgate features a built-in, weather-tight storage compartment for tools or emergency gear, maximizing bed utility. Multiple tie-down points and a 120V power outlet in the bed allow the Canyon to function as a mobile workstation or a basecamp for outdoor adventures. The dampened tailgate ensures smooth operation, preventing accidental drops and extending hardware longevity.
